Flexible Spending Accounts and Dependent Care Accounts. Parent and SpinCo shall take all actions necessary or appropriate so that, effective as of the Effective Time, (i) the account balances (whether positive or negative) (the “Transferred Cafeteria Plan Balances”) under the SpinCo Welfare Plans that are flexible spending plans or dependent care plans (collectively, the “SpinCo Cafeteria Plans”) of the Retained Business Participants who are participants in the SpinCo Cafeteria Plans shall be transferred to one or more comparable plans of TRGP or its Affiliates (collectively, the “TRGP Cafeteria Plans”); (ii) the elections, contribution levels, and coverage levels of such Retained Business Participants shall apply under the TRGP Cafeteria Plans in the same manner as under the applicable SpinCo Cafeteria Plan; and (iii) such Retained Business Participants shall be reimbursed from the TRGP Cafeteria Plans for claims incurred at any time during the plan year of the applicable SpinCo Cafeteria Plan in which the Effective Time occurs that are submitted to the TRGP Cafeteria Plan from and after the Effective Time on the same basis and the same terms and conditions as under the applicable SpinCo Cafeteria Plan. As soon as practicable after the Effective Time, and in any event within 10 business days after the amount of the Transferred Cafeteria Plan Balances are determined, SpinCo shall pay Parent the net aggregate amount of the Transferred Cafeteria Plan Balances, if such amount is positive, and Parent shall pay SpinCo the net aggregate amount of the Transferred Cafeteria Plan Balances, if such amount is negative.
